RCW 29A.12.050

Approval by secretary of state required.

2025 c 329 s 2; 2003 c 111 s 305; 1990 c 59 s 21; 1982 c 40 s 4

(1) Prior to use in conducting any primary or election, the secretary of state must approve systems used in the conduct of elections, including:

(a) Voting systems, voting devices, or vote tallying systems, unless approved under this chapter or the former chapter 29.34 RCW before March 22, 1982; and

(b) Any mechanical, electromechanical, or electronic equipment or platform, including software, firmware, or hardware that is used:

(i) In issuing a ballot;

(ii) To facilitate voters' response to a required notice;

(iii) To provide an electronic means for submission of a ballot declaration signature under RCW 29A.60.165; or

(iv) To issue, authenticate, or validate voter identification.

(2) The secretary of state may, after review, determine that a modification, change, or improvement to any voting system or component of a system does not require a full reexamination or reapproval by the secretary of state under RCW 29A.12.020.
